Output 55fc34bc9ae406e60093a84df875a2566cc8ea557d019e8626e36e632f35e1d8:4

value
952272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 529cd9933699b6a2489c830386f2a7ec88645613 OP_EQUAL
address
39DqEPvrAdu5ozSHwX2d7aEKSGhRne4iVp
transaction
55fc34bc9ae406e60093a84df875a2566cc8ea557d019e8626e36e632f35e1d8
confirmations
279124
spent
true